Meaning
Definitions
noun
degree of psychological or intellectual profundity
noun
the attribute or quality of being deep, strong, or intense
“the depth of his breathing”
noun
the extent downward or backward or inward
“the depth of the water”
noun
the intellectual ability to penetrate deeply into ideas
noun
(usually plural) a low moral state
“he had sunk to the depths of addiction”
